Data engineering
Approaches for supporting ad-hoc deep dives without compromising production data integrity through sanitized snapshots and sandboxes.
Exploring resilient methods to empower analysts with flexible, on-demand data access while preserving production systems, using sanitized snapshots, isolated sandboxes, governance controls, and scalable tooling for trustworthy, rapid insights.
X Linkedin Facebook Reddit Email Bluesky
Published by Jerry Jenkins
August 07, 2025 - 3 min Read
In modern data ecosystems, the demand for quick, ad-hoc deep dives often collides with the stringent need to protect production data. Teams require flexible access to representative datasets without exposing sensitive information or destabilizing operational systems. The challenge is to balance speed and safety: enabling exploratory analysis, model testing, and hypothesis validation while maintaining audit trails, lineage, and data quality. The approach hinges on careful design of data access layers, robust masking, and predictable environments that resemble production semantics yet operate in isolation. By aligning analytics needs with rigorous data governance, organizations can shorten discovery cycles without inviting risk to live processes or customer privacy.
A principled strategy begins with a formal catalog of data assets and usage policies. Data producers and stewards define which attributes are sensitive, how they should be protected, and under what circumstances datasets may be provisioned for experimentation. Automated request workflows then translate policy into concrete tasks: cloning, masking, or subsetting data, spinning up ephemeral environments, and granting time-bounded permissions. The resulting process should be repeatable, auditable, and transparent to both engineers and analysts. With clear SLAs and rollback mechanisms, teams can pursue ambitious inquiries while remaining compliant with regulatory requirements and internal standards.
Designing governance-friendly data access patterns for experiments
The core concept of sanitized snapshots is to capture a faithful, privacy-preserving view of data that supports meaningful analysis without exposing the full production truth. Techniques include data masking, tokenization, differential privacy, and synthetic data generation that preserves distributions, correlations, and edge cases relevant to analytics workloads. Establishing deterministic sampling helps ensure reproducibility across sessions, while deterministic redaction keeps auditability intact. Infrastructure should provide automated lineage so analysts can trace results back to source systems, ensuring that transformations remain visible and accountable. The result is a dependable foundation for experiments, dashboards, and model development without compromising sensitive information.
ADVERTISEMENT
ADVERTISEMENT
Sandboxed environments offer another essential layer, isolating workloads from production pipelines while preserving the experience of working with real data. Containers or lightweight virtual machines host sandboxed databases, query engines, and BI tools that mirror production schemas. Access controls enforce least privilege, with temporary credentials expiring after defined windows. Observability tools monitor resource usage and access attempts, producing alerts for unusual activity. In practice, sandboxing lowers the risk of misconfigurations or accidental data leakage during explorations. It also accelerates onboarding, because new analysts can test queries and pipelines against representative datasets without waiting for long provisioning cycles.
Techniques to preserve integrity during iterative analytics and feedback loops
A practical approach to ad-hoc analysis starts with standardized data provisioning templates. Templates encode allowed datasets, masking rules, and environment configurations, reducing cognitive load and ensuring consistency across teams. Automation orchestrates the end-to-end flow: verify policy compliance, provision a sanitized dataset, deploy a sandbox, and grant time-limited access. Templates also document the intended use case, expected outputs, and retention terms, which reinforces responsible data use. By separating discovery from production, analysts can explore hypotheses with confidence, while data stewards retain control over how information travels through the system.
ADVERTISEMENT
ADVERTISEMENT
Lifecycle management is critical to avoid data sprawl. After an exploration concludes, automated decommissioning removes temporary resources, applies retention policies, and archives results with appropriate metadata. This discipline minimizes stale copies and reduces the risk of outdated data affecting downstream analyses. Moreover, embedding observability into the provisioning process helps detect drift between sanitized datasets and their production counterparts, enabling rapid remediation. When done well, governance-aware experimentation becomes a repeatable, scalable practice that supports continuous learning without eroding data integrity.
Practical engineering patterns that scale sanitized access and sandboxing
Iterative analytics demand stable references and dependable environments. Copy-on-write storage, immutable snapshots, and versioned schemas provide reliable baselines for successive experiments. Analysts can compare outcomes across iterations without altering the underlying synthetic or masked data. Version control for data transformations further strengthens reproducibility, allowing teams to backtrack when models underperform or biases emerge. Additionally, standardized testing suites verify that sanitization rules produce acceptable results across scenarios. Together, these techniques empower rapid iteration while keeping the sanctity of production data intact.
A culture of collaboration is essential in ad-hoc deep dives. Data engineers, data scientists, and business stakeholders should converge on shared definitions of success, common terminology, and agreed-upon quality metrics. Regular reviews of masking schemes, privacy risks, and dataset refresh cadences help prevent drift and misalignment. Clear communication channels, coupled with automated reporting on who accessed what, when, and why, reinforce accountability. When teams trust the process and understand the safeguards, they can pursue insights with agility while maintaining rigorous data stewardship.
ADVERTISEMENT
ADVERTISEMENT
Real-world implications and organizational impact of sanitized, sandboxed analytics
Implementing scalable sanitization begins with centralized policy engines that translate business rules into technical controls. A policy-as-code approach enables automated enforcement across data catalogs, provisioning engines, and sandbox platforms. Coupled with data catalogs that reveal lineage and sensitivity classifications, this enables analysts to discover appropriate datasets confidently. Encrypted transport, in-flight masking, and strict access controls ensure that even transient data remains protected during transfer. The combination of policy automation and catalog visibility reduces the cognitive load on analysts and elevates security to a first-class concern rather than an afterthought.
A robust sandbox infrastructure must be resilient and easy to manage. Orchestration layers should handle workload isolation, resource quotas, and lifecycle events with minimal human intervention. Automated health checks and fault isolation prevent sneaky issues from bleeding into production data. For teams using cloud-native stacks, leveraging managed database services, ephemeral environments, and single-tenant sandboxes can dramatically shorten provisioning times. The payoff is a responsive, scalable platform where ad-hoc investigations feel immediate, yet every action is contained within safe, governed boundaries.
Enterprises that institutionalize sanitized snapshots and sandboxed data access typically see faster discovery cycles, higher experimentation throughput, and improved stakeholder confidence. The encoded protections reduce regulatory anxiety and support responsible AI initiatives by ensuring data provenance and bias mitigation are integral to every exploration. Beyond risk management, these patterns foster a culture of curiosity and accountability. Teams can prototype new metrics, validate business hypotheses, and optimize operations with fewer bottlenecks, all while preserving the integrity and trust of the production environment.
Long-term success hinges on continuous improvement and disciplined measurement. Regular audits, metrics dashboards, and feedback loops help refine masking techniques and sandbox mechanics. Investment in tooling that automates policy enforcement, data quality checks, and environment provisioning pays dividends in reduced incident rates and faster time-to-insight. As data ecosystems evolve, the core philosophy remains consistent: provide safe, realistic, and auditable access for ad-hoc analysis while upholding production data integrity through sanitized snapshots and sandboxed workspaces.
Related Articles
Data engineering
This evergreen guide explains how probabilistic data structures, reconciliation strategies, and governance processes align to eliminate duplicate records across distributed data stores while preserving accuracy, performance, and auditable lineage.
July 18, 2025
Data engineering
A practical, evergreen guide describing strategies to embed unit conversion and normalization into canonical data transformation libraries, ensuring consistent measurements, scalable pipelines, and reliable downstream analytics across diverse data sources.
August 08, 2025
Data engineering
Canonical transformation patterns empower cross-team collaboration by reducing duplication, standardizing logic, and enabling scalable maintenance through reusable, well-documented transformation primitives and governance practices.
July 19, 2025
Data engineering
A practical guide to creating durable dataset contracts that clearly articulate expectations, ensure cross-system compatibility, and support disciplined, automated change management across evolving data ecosystems.
July 26, 2025
Data engineering
This evergreen guide explains how to implement feature importance and lineage tracking to illuminate model decisions, improve governance, and foster trust from stakeholders by tracing inputs, transformations, and outcomes.
July 25, 2025
Data engineering
A practical guide to designing robust snapshot retention, rotation, and archival strategies that support compliant, scalable analytics over extended time horizons across complex data ecosystems.
August 12, 2025
Data engineering
This evergreen guide explores incremental schema reconciliation, revealing principles, methods, and practical steps for identifying semantic mismatches, then resolving them with accuracy, efficiency, and minimal disruption to data pipelines.
August 04, 2025
Data engineering
A practical, evergreen guide to capturing, interpreting, and acting on dataset utilization signals that shape sustainable platform growth, informed deprecations, and data-driven roadmap decisions for diverse teams.
July 16, 2025
Data engineering
A practical guide to classify data assets by criticality, enabling focused monitoring, resilient backups, and proactive incident response that protect operations, uphold compliance, and sustain trust in data-driven decisions.
July 15, 2025
Data engineering
In today’s data-driven landscape, privacy-first design reshapes how products deliver insights, balancing user protection with robust analytics, ensuring responsible data use while preserving meaningful consumer value and trust.
August 12, 2025
Data engineering
Effective strategies enable continuous integration of evolving schemas, support backward compatibility, automate compatibility checks, and minimize service disruption during contract negotiation and progressive rollout across distributed microservices ecosystems.
July 21, 2025
Data engineering
This evergreen guide explains a practical approach to continuous query profiling, outlining data collection, instrumentation, and analytics that empower teams to detect regressions, locate hotspots, and seize optimization opportunities before they impact users or costs.
August 02, 2025